4.0 out of 5 stars Great value, really fast, quiet
Overall great laptop, amazing value. Great for work and casual gaming. Powerful CPU and RAM setup. Okish GPU. More than decent for watching YouTube, Netflix, coding, word processing etc
Battery 5 to 2 hours depending on workload. 47wh.
Gaming
CS2 1080p low settings – 30 to 60 fps, 45 avg. I was quite surprised how powerful an integrated GPU have become. Check out YouTube for games/performances.
Can support 2 other monitors, via HDMI and USB C.
Lovely keyboard to type on.
Screen is TN 60hz, and low contrast. Fine for indoor use, don’t expect miracles. Webcam is 1080p.
Speakers aren’t that great, but you really should get a Bluetooth speaker/headphones if you care about music.

4.0 out of 5 stars For £390, this is great!
First of all, yes the keyboard doesn’t light up. Second of all I don’t care. This machine is a beast for the money. It has a decent i5, 16gb of DDR5 Ram and useable 420gb of storage.
This machine is perfect for word processing, spreadsheets and presentation work. Browsing the Web is effortless and watching Netflix is perfectly acceptable. Is the screen stunning, bursting with colours like a £2000 OLED laptop? Obviously not. Is it completely usable…100%
I tested cloud gaming with the Xbox app and with a decent Internet connection it ran extremely well.
Sound isn’t great but I always use headphones. It has a 3.5mm jack and also runs Bluetooth so no problems there.
My only real gripes were the Lenovo software apps and a few other unwanted programs. Easy enough to uninstall. Additionally the laptop does run a little loud averaging 50db when performing updates and other heavy load bearing tasks.
I’d say for £390 this is a sensational laptop.
Also…. Still don’t care about the keyboard lighting up.
